chore: Make field declarations explicit

This used to be valid code:

```
class Foo {
  constructor() {
    this.bar = ‘string’;
  }
}
```

This will now fail since ‘bar’ is not explicitly
defined as a field. We now have to write:

```
class Foo {
  bar:string; // << REQUIRED
  constructor() {
    this.bar = ‘string’;
  }
}
```
